Current Priorities
Issue
Marine Theft – Operation Headway
Action
Working with boat owners & lake users to encourage reporting of suspicious incidents and conducting joint patrols on & around Windermere and Coniston.
Conducting Crime prevention work with boat owners & lake users.
Multi agency patrols conducted on Windermere. Joint investigations with other forces leading to the arrest of three persons. Most recently 3 more males arrested following reports of behaviour on the lake. Vehicle stop searched and outboard motors and other equipment located in the vehicle. All 3 Adult males released on Bail with conditions not to return to Cumbria whilst the investigation continues. We continue to work with our partners within Westmorland and Furness Council and the Lake District National Park to improve security, and to prevent and detect offences.
Issue
Road Safety - Speeding cars in Grange particularly Kents Bank Road
Action
To tackle this we will look to place a speed indicator device on the street to gather some data to give a better understanding of the issue. Once this data has been analysed decisions on the next steps will be taken.
Issue
Road safety - Parking Fernleigh Road, Grange over Sands
Action
Reports of inconsiderate parking with motorists obstructing the pavements and narrowing the road making it more difficult for vehicles to pass. Officers will be visiting the area and steps will be taken to deal with any vehicles found to be causing an unnecessary obstruction.
Fernleigh road can have an update of NPT officers have attended the street and conducted letter drops and visits to inform and advise residents, followed by further visits and Traffic Offence reports being issued for unnecessary obstruction.
